The Samsung SSD 870 EVO 1TB is a high-performance 2.5-inch SATA internal solid-state drive delivering up to 560/530 MB/s sequential read/write speeds. Featuring Intelligent Turbo Write technology for sustained fast performance and Samsung Magician 6 software for drive management, it’s designed for professionals seeking reliable, speedy storage compatible with desktops and laptops.

This is my back up drive for my M2 SSD.
Samsungs are great drives. This one is to replace my backup drive that quit working.I had built one of my PCs on a budget and used Patriot 250 to build the OS on. I later bought a Samsung M2 for the OS that installed neatly on the board. So I initially cloned the Patriot to the Samsung.Later, when I used backup software, the M2 (Source Drive) listed as Drive 2.Weird. Since it is the C: drive for the OS.Thus my Patriot regular SSD (Now being used at Target Drive) backup drive, showed as Drive 1.I did this for over a year until my backup quietly failed.And then I realized the Patriot is smaller by 9GB. It is 223, the Samsung is 232.Before I came to that realization, I thought I had a software problem, so I reinstalled Discwizard(Note, you must have One Seagate drive for versions later that SeagateDiscWizard_28500)and then used an upgraded version.The problem went like this: clone/backup restarted into DOS then opened it's UEFI dialog and then the clone disk window opened. I looked like it was about to start copying.Then it just restarted. No error message was ever shown. The backup quietly failed.I saw with the Windows Disk Manager that the Patriot was too small for the partition backup from the Samsung.The fix was easy, Samsung drive is now backed up to Samsung all great.I mention this for anyone who has a phantom cloning failure.You probably just need to go shopping.
